Sorting Scraps
QUOTE
keep some small squares of paper cut up and tape next to where you cut your film to mark the size and kind of film that you are rolling up to save as scraps, I normally have these cut up in a jar to where all I have to do is right on them and tape it to the film...I notice that if I dont have these pieces of paper ready, instead of taking the time to rip a piece of paper and right on it, I seem to pile the scrap pieces up without marking them which ends up being a pain in the azz later when I have to sort through them.

LCD monitor light for cutting back glass
QUOTE
If you have a broken/old LCD monitor take out the back-light and plug it into a 12v point, its what i use 15" and only 5 mm thick can be placed any where and works great for me.
